Cast/Crew screening















We started Reserved To Fight five years ago a week after Fox Company 2/23 returned home from Operation Iraqi Freedom. We began documenting the stories of the marines in Fox Company and the longer we filmed their journey of coming home, the more important we felt it was to share their stories. Along the way, we were picked up by ITVS (a PBS affiliate) which helped us complete the film. Paul Reickhoff with the Iraq and Afghanistan Veterans of America also jumped on board to help us finish the film, raise awareness and take action. We are so excited that it is finally finished, and we are so grateful for everyone who helped to make this film possible, especially the veterans who shared their lives with us and the world. We are now awaiting a premiere at a film festival, but on Tuesday, we had a private friends/family/cast/crew screening, and it was so great to see a full house and such a positive response. Thanks to everyone who came and showed their support. It was so wonderful to see so many people as passionate about helping veterans as we are. One of my favorite moments of the night was when someone from the audience came up to one of the marines in the film after the screening was over and through tears expressed how grateful she was for the film. She told him that finally she was able to understand her father who landed on the beaches of Normandy in WWII that through his whole life never talked about his experiences. But after seeing the film, she finally felt like she understood him. I can't wait for everyone to get a chance to see this film.
